GD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review
2,222 of the 8,187 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in General Dynamics (GD)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$80.4B — up 2.1% from $78.7B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 218 funds opened new GD positions and 127 closed out — a net gain of 91 holders — while 892 added to existing stakes and 761 trimmed.
The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$311M.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$627M.
